Come, Spirit of God, holy Lord

Author: Martin Luther, 1483-1546 Hymnal: Together in Song #399 (1999) Meter: 8.8.8.8.8.8.10.8 Topics: Confidence; Courage; Endurance; Faith; Grace; Holy Spirit; Invocation; Light; People of God; Prayer for Illimination; Service; Truth; Unity of the Church; Worship The Word Lyrics: 1 Come, Spirit of God, holy Lord, with all your graces now out-poured on each believer's mind and heart; your fervent love to them impart. Lord, by the brightness of your light in holy faith your church unite; from every land and every tongue this to your praise, O Lord, our God, be sung: Alleluia, alleluia! 2 Come, Spirit of light, guide divine, now cause the Word of life to shine. Teach us to know our God aright and call him Father with delight. From every error keep us free; let none but Christ our master be, that we in living faith abide, in him, our Lord, with all our might confide. Alleluia, alleluia! 3 Come, Spirit of fire, comfort true, grant us the will your work to do and in your service to abide; let trials turn us not side. Lord, by your power prepare each heart, and to our weakness strength impart that bravely here we may contend, through life and death to you, our Lord, ascend. Alleluia, alleluia! Scripture: 2 Corinthians 4:4-7 Languages: English Tune Title: KOMM HEILIGER GEIST

Break Now the Bread of Life

Author: Mary Artemisia Lathbury Hymnal: Voices United #501 (1996) Meter: 10.10.10.10 Topics: The Church at Worship Scripture; liturgical Songs of Illumination; Bible; Biblical Narrative; Calmness and Serenity; Comfort/Consolation; Holy Spirit Illumination; Jesus Christ Presence; Jesus Christ Word; Last Supper; Peace (Inner, Calmness, Serenity; Service Music Prayer for Illumination; Truth; Word of God; Proper 13 Year A; Easter 7 Year B; Proper 9 Year B; Proper 13 Year B; Palm/Passion Sunday Year C First Line: Break now the bread of life, Saviour, to me Lyrics: 1 Break now the bread of life, Saviour, to me, as once you broke the loaves beside the sea. Beyond the sacred page I seek you, Lord; my spirit waits for you, O Living Word. 2 Bless your own truth, dear Christ, to me, to me, as when you blessed the bread by Galilee; then shall all bondage cease, all fetters fall, and I shall find my peace, my all-in-all. Languages: English Tune Title: BREAD OF LIFE
